Technical advantages:

  • Adopting the principle of laser backscatter, it is not afraid of beam oscillation caused by mechanical vibration of the flue and uneven refractive index caused by uneven flue gas temperature;
  • Single end installation, no need for optical alignment;
  • Equipped with on-site display function, it can directly read the dust concentration on site;
  • After modulation, the laser beam greatly improves the anti-interference ability of the system;
  • Instrument design implementationNo tools availableThe idea of on-site installation aims to minimize the complexity of on-site installation to the greatest extent possible;
  • Adopting standards(4-20)mAIndustrial standard current output, easy to connect;
  • The overall power consumption of the instrument is very low, approximately3Wabout;

The general standard setting parameters can be applied to flue wall thickness less than400mmThe diameter of the flue is larger than the instrument nameplate, and the measurement area size can be customized under special requirements. Users can also make adjustments with the recognition and guidance of maintenance personnel.

Application scenarios

This dust tester can be used for real-time continuous measurement of particulate pollutant concentrations from various pollution emission sources,

It can be equipped with a smoke monitoring system, or it can be connected separately or several to form a smoke monitoring network, sharing a front desk. The instrument can be used for monitoring smoke and dust in power plants, steel mills, cement plants, etc., and can also be used for process control of dust removal equipment and other powder engineering.
